Lastly we have Discounts and Voucher codes.

I would do no shopping if not for discounts and voucher codes. For any big purchase my first port of call is Quidco. This website offers discounts and most importantly cash back on purchases. Some of these cashbacks are minuscule but its still more than nothing. This site also gives you the ability to sign up a card and for instore purchases at certain stores you will still get cashback when using this nominated card. I've made on average £70 a year on this site for the last three years.

For most discount codes, especially those for fast food i simply google search the store/restaurant "voucher codes". This usually brings up a plethera of sites to choose from.
